  • Explore the cutting edge of science, technology, and human progress to understand what is coming next with AI Cancer Researcher Tane Hunter. There are better ways of doing stuff in the 21st century and you can be a part of creating and investing in a better future. You'll hear from scientists, entrepreneurs, nerds, and technologists who are all on a common mission to foster intelligent optimistic thinking about the future.

    Since its launch, Groundswell has grown into a powerful community committed to funding and accelerating strategic climate action in Australia. Tane talks to co-founders Arielle Gamble and Clare Herschell about how their climate anxiety meant they had to do something together.

    The famous Danish toy brick can unlock your company's creative potential. Dr Kate Raynes-Goldie is a LEGO Serious Play Certified Facilitator in Australia and a cultural anthropologist says it's all about the unacknowledged power of play.

    Tim is a new media entrepreneur who has co-founded several digital media ventures, most notably Junkee Media. He is also a writer, his new book, Killer Thinking is all about applying creativity to your business as well as our weekly dose of good news you probably missed.
